Days in Modern Israel: Culture, Cuisine, and Community
Modern Israel thrives with a dynamic blend of tradition and modernity. This vibrant culture is a melting pot of influences, stemming from its diverse population of Jews, Arabs, and other ethnicities. Israelis are known for their warm hospitality, clear in their love of spending time together. A key part of Israeli life is the culinary scene, which offers a tasty mix of traditional Middle Eastern dishes and innovative fusion cuisine.
From falafel to sabich, the flavors are sure to satisfy. Furthermore, Israel boasts a strong sense of community, with residents actively participating in a range of social and cultural events.

Israel's Contribution to Global Art and Literature
Israel, a nation with a deep history and culture, has made a significant contribution to global art and literature. Throughout its founding, Israeli artists and writers have crafted works that delve into themes of identity, conflict, and the human experience. These works often reflect the country's distinctive outlook on the world, blending tradition with modernity.
Israeli literature is renowned for its moving prose and poetry. Pioneers like S.Y. Agnon, Amos Oz, and David Grossman have gained international acclaim for their profound works.
